Working in Des Moines
Employment Landscape
Job seekers in Des Moines are encountering a mixed market marked by cautious investment and sector-specific shifts. Tech employment has grown nearly 8 percent over the past three years, with software developer wages rising sharply—a sign that the city is quietly emerging as a regional tech hub. Meanwhile, the industrial real estate market remains steady, although construction is slowing and vacancy is tightening. On the downside, manufacturing job losses have mounted—over 5,000 jobs since mid‑2024—while wage growth for entry‑level roles has been sluggish. Local large employers, such as Hy‑Vee, continue to invest in their technology teams even as they expand overseas, and firms like ITA Group and Excell Brands are expanding their facilities and hiring locally. Des Moines job seekers may find opportunities in growth pockets, but will also face stiff competition where wages remain stagnant and traditional industries retrench.

Hiring Patterns
Technology and logistics roles show real momentum as firms invest in digital infrastructure and distribution capacity. Employment in manufacturing and traditional office sectors is contracting or flat, and job openings in those areas may be scarce or lower‑paying. Healthcare office space remains tight, suggesting some opportunity for administrative and support hiring in medical practices.
